Hijacked bus plows into pedestrians in eastern China, killing 8
A man has been arrested after he hijacked a bus in eastern China and plowed into pedestrians, killing 8 people and injuring more than 20 others, local officials say. Only few details were leased.
The incident happened at about 3:20 p.m. local time on Tuesday when the suspect, a 48-year-old man named Qiu, attacked people with a knife in Longyan, a city in eastern China’s Fujian Province.
He then hijacked a bus and used it to run over pedestrians, according to the state-run Xinhua news agency. The man was taken into custody a short time later.
At least 8 people were killed and 22 others were injured, according to Xinhua. It said the suspect had a long-running conflict with an official of the neighborhood committee.
Other details about the attack were not immediately released.
